Largemouth Bass in the Bridgeview, Illinois area? You'll find them primarily in smaller lakes, ponds, and canals connected to the Chicago Sanitary and Ship Canal. While the canal itself can hold bass, the calmer backwaters and connected lakes are usually more productive. Spring and fall are peak seasons. Focus on areas with cover like docks, weed edges, and submerged timber. During the spawn in spring, look for bedding bass in shallow, protected areas. Soft plastics like Texas-rigged worms and creature baits are always a good choice. In the fall, bass will be actively feeding as they prepare for winter, so crankbaits and spinnerbaits can be effective. A local tip: Pay close attention to water clarity, as the canal system can be quite murky. Use lures with rattles or bright colors to help bass find them. Also, be mindful of boat traffic and current, especially in the main canal.
